Application software
An application program (software application, or application, or app for short) is a computer program designed to carry out a specific task other than one relating to the operation of the computer itself, typically to be used by end-users.

Computer program
A computer program is a sequence or set of instructions in a programming language for a computer to execute.

Computer science
Computer science is the study of computation, information, and automation.
